verilog 导线模块
时间: 2023-09-18 19:12:30 浏览: 40
Verilog中的导线模块指的是wire类型的模块,用于连接各个模块之间的信号传输。导线模块可以用于连接其他模块的输入和输出端口,也可以用于内部信号的传输。其定义方式如下:
```
wire [n-1:0] wire_name;
```
其中,n表示导线的位宽,wire_name为导线的名称。在Verilog中,导线模块不能被实例化,只能作为信号线使用。我们可以在其他模块中将信号线连接到导线上,实现不同模块之间的通信。
相关问题
verilog加密模块
Verilog加密模块是一种基于Verilog语言设计的数字逻辑电路模块,用于实现数据的加密和解密功能。它通常包括加密算法、密钥管理、数据输入输出接口等功能模块。
在Verilog加密模块中,加密算法是核心部分,它采用不同的数学运算和逻辑运算来对数据进行处理,以实现加密过程。常见的加密算法包括DES、AES等。密钥管理模块用于生成、存储和管理加密过程中需要的密钥,确保数据的安全性。数据输入输出接口处理外部数据的输入和输出,保证加密模块能够与其他模块或外部系统进行有效的数据交换。
设计Verilog加密模块需要考虑到数据处理速度、资源利用和安全性等方面。通常需要对加密算法进行优化,以提高处理速度,并合理利用FPGA或ASIC等硬件资源。同时,加密模块需要采取一定的安全措施,防止外部攻击和数据泄露。
Verilog加密模块在信息安全领域有着广泛的应用,例如网络通信领域的数据加密、存储设备的数据安全等。设计和实现一个高效、安全的Verilog加密模块,对于保障数据的安全性和完整性具有重要意义。
verilog蓝牙模块
Verilog蓝牙模块是一种基于Verilog硬件描述语言开发的蓝牙通信功能的模块。Verilog是一种硬件描述语言,用于设计和验证硬件电路。而蓝牙是一种无线通信技术,广泛应用于各种设备的短距离通信。
Verilog蓝牙模块的设计要求在硬件电路层面上实现蓝牙通信的功能。在设计中,需要考虑蓝牙通信的特性和标准,如频率范围、数据传输速率、通信协议等。同时,还需要考虑FPGA芯片的资源限制,确保蓝牙模块可以在特定FPGA芯片上进行实现。
Verilog蓝牙模块通常包括多个子模块,用于实现蓝牙通信的不同功能。其中包括蓝牙模块的收发器、数据处理单元、调制解调器等。收发器用于将数字信号转换为蓝牙通信所需的射频信号,以及将射频信号转换为数字信号。数据处理单元负责对传输的数据进行处理和解析,确保数据的完整性和正确性。调制解调器用于将数字信号转换为蓝牙通信所需的调制解调信号,以及将调制解调信号转换为数字信号。
使用Verilog蓝牙模块可以方便地在FPGA平台上集成蓝牙通信功能。通过对Verilog蓝牙模块的配置和连接,可以实现设备与设备之间的无线通信。例如,在物联网应用中,可以使用Verilog蓝牙模块将传感器数据通过蓝牙无线传输给云端服务器进行处理和分析。这样可以方便地实现设备之间的数据交互和远程控制。
总之,Verilog蓝牙模块是一种用于实现蓝牙通信功能的硬件模块,通过Verilog硬件描述语言进行设计与开发。它可以应用于各种场景,为设备之间的无线通信提供了便捷的解决方案。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)